As the small o󰀨-road engine/equipment owner, you should however
be aware that Rato may deny your warranty coverage if your small
o󰀨-road engine/equipment or a part has failed due to abuse, neglect,
or improper maintenance or unapproved modications.
You are responsible for presenting your small o󰀨-road engine/
equipment to a Rato distribution center or service center as soon
as the problem exists. The warranty repairs shall be completed in a
reasonable amount of time, not to exceed 30 days.

DEFECTS WARRANTY REQUIREMENTS
A. The warranty period begins on the date the small o󰀨-road engine/
equipment is delivered to an ultimate purchaser.
B. General Emissions Warranty Coverage. Rato warrants to the
ultimate purchaser and each subsequent owner that the engine or
equipment is: Designed, built, and equipped so as to conform with
all applicable regulations adopted by the Air Resources Board;
and Free from defects in materials and workmanship that causes
the failure of a warranted part for a period of two years.
C. The warranty on emission-related parts will be interpreted as
follows:
1. Any warranted part that is not scheduled for replacement
as required maintenance in the written instructions must be
warranted for the warranty period dened in Subsection (b)(2).
If any such part fails during the period of warranty coverage, it
must be repaired or replaced by Rato according to Subsection
(4) below. Any such part repaired or replaced under the warranty
must be warranted for the remaining warranty period.
